### CI Note: Soft deletes breaking order fixtures (Cartwheel)

New folks: if the Cartwheel integration suite fails on order counts, check for leftover soft-deleted rows. Our orders table marks rows deleted rather than removing them, and the fixture loader used to ignore the deleted flag, inflating counts between runs. The loader now filters deleted rows by default, but older branches may not have the patch. The fixed runner build is noted below.

trace token, fafog-kageg: htk4_98e6

## Deployment

The Pinewell reminder job runs as a nightly cron on the shared worker box, not in the main Clinica stack — yes, we know, it's on the list. Deploys are just a pull-and-restart: ship the new build, bounce the systemd unit, and watch the first run complete before walking away. Secrets come from the vault sidecar; everything else is plain env config. The values the job expects at startup are listed below.

service settings:
WENATH_PIN=5007
WENATH_METRICS_HOST=metrics.wenath.tolvaqlabs.corp
WENATH_LOG_LEVEL=debug
WENATH_TENANT=rusox

## ImageCache leak (Pixelbarn)

The Pixelbarn thumbnail cache leaked memory because evicted entries kept GPU handles alive. Fixed in v2.4 by forcing handle release on eviction. If RSS climbs past 2GB on the render nodes, suspect a regression here first. Repro: hammer `/thumbs` with varied sizes for ten minutes and watch the heap. The cache metrics exporter needs auth to push to the Grovestat collector, configured via the env file on each node. The collector push token goes on the next line.

vault entry, kafog-yahop: COURIER_KEY8=0faa53ae

**Mgmt Meeting Minutes — Retiring the Brightline Range**

Quick recap for sales leads at Fenholt Supplies: we agreed to retire the Brightline fixture range by year-end. Remaining stock moves to clearance pricing next month, and accounts on standing orders get migrated to the Lumetta range. Trade-in incentives were approved in principle. The confidential note on next steps sits just below.

board note of bajof-bajeg: The pricing group signed off on a budget of $13.4 million for Project Sildor. The renewal with Lamixek Holdings closes at $48.9 million a year, 49 percent above the last contract.